如何使用 CSS 提升网站外观和功能
微信号
AI自助建站398元:18925225629
引言
层叠样式表 (CSS) 是现代网页设计中必不可少的工具,它允许开发者使用代码控制网站的外观和功能。掌握 CSS 的基本原理对于创建引人入胜且用户友好的网站至关重要。本文将深入探讨如何使用 CSS 来提升网站的外观和功能,为初学者提供一个逐步的指南。
1. 了解 CSS 的结构
CSS 代码使用一种简单的语法,由选择器、属性和值组成。
选择器指定要应用样式的 HTML 元素。
属性定义元素的特定外观或行为。
值指定属性的实际值。
例如,以下 CSS 将所有 `` 段落文本设为红色:
```css
p {
color: red;
}
```
2. 应用 CSS 样式
有两种主要方法可以将 CSS 样式应用到 HTML 文档:
内联样式:直接在 HTML 元素中使用 `style` 属性应用样式。
外部样式表:将样式存储在单独的 `.css` 文件中,并通过 ` ` 标签链接到 HTML 文档。
外部样式表通常是首选,因为它使样式更易于维护和重复使用。
3. 样式元素外观
CSS 提供了大量属性来控制元素的外观,包括:
文本属性:`color`、`font-family`、`font-size`
背景属性:`background-color`、`background-image`
边框属性:`border-style`、`border-width`、`border-color`
定位属性:`position`、`top`、`left`
4. 布局和定位
CSS 还允许您控制元素在页面上的布局和定位。主要布局模式包括:
流式布局:元素根据它们在 HTML 文档中的顺序排列。
浮动布局:元素可以水平浮动,允许它们重叠。
定位布局:元素可以绝对或相对放置在页面上,不受流式布局的限制。
5. 响应式设计
响应式设计允许网站根据设备屏幕大小自动调整布局和样式。使用 CSS 媒体查询,您可以创建针对不同设备或分辨率的特定样式:
```css
@media screen and (min-width: 768px) {
body {
font-size: larger;
}
}
```
6. 动画和过渡
CSS 提供了 `animation` 和 `transition` 属性,允许您创建动画和过渡效果。您可以使用这些属性来淡入淡出元素、移动它们或为鼠标悬停事件添加效果。
7. 使用 CSS 框架
CSS 框架是预构建的 CSS 库,可以帮助您快速轻松地创建网站。流行的 CSS 框架包括:
Bootstrap
Foundation
Materialize
这些框架提供了许多预定义的样式、布局和组件,使开发过程更加高效。
8. 调试技巧
调试 CSS 问题时,可以使用以下技巧:
使用浏览器开发者工具检查样式和 DOM 结构。
使用 CSS 预处理器(如 Sass 或 Less)来简化和组织代码。
保持 CSS 代码整齐有序,使用缩进和注释。
结论
掌握 CSS 是现代网页设计中必备的技能。通过了解 CSS 的结构、应用样式、控制元素外观、布局元素、实现响应式设计、创建动画和过渡以及使用 CSS 框架,您可以创建引人入胜、用户友好且功能强大的网站。持续练习和探索 CSS 的先进功能将帮助您提升开发技能并创建令人惊叹的在线体验。
微信号
AI自助建站398元:18925225629
相关文章
发表评论